Clinical features

Ask about d
  • previous systemic disease: diabetes, vascular disease
  • known renal disease, previous renal function tests
  • recent systemic disturbances: MI, GI bleeding, major surgery
  • medication: ACE inhibitors, aminoglycosides, radiocontrast, other antibiotics
Look for evidence of d
  • volume contraction
    • sunken eyes b
    • dry axillae b
    • dry nose or mouth mucous membranes b
    • longitudinal tongue furrows b
    • a low jugular venous pressure a
  • volume overload 
    • a high jugular venous pressure a
    • pulmonary oedema or peripheral oedema d

  • outflow obstruction
  • infection
  • joint or skin problems
